What Does FCBC Do?

First Community Bankshares, Inc. was established in 1874 and functions as the financial holding company for First Community Bank. The bank offers a comprehensive suite of banking products and services tailored to individuals and businesses. These include an array of deposit accounts such as demand deposit, savings, and money market accounts, as well as certificates of deposit and individual retirement arrangements. Lending solutions encompass commercial, consumer, and real estate mortgage loans, alongside lines of credit. The bank also provides credit and debit cards and ATM services. Beyond traditional banking, First Community Bank provides corporate and personal trust services, wealth management, estate administration, and investment advisory services. The company caters to a diverse clientele across sectors like education, government, healthcare, coal mining, gas extraction, retail, construction, manufacturing, tourism, and transportation. As of December 31, 2021, First Community Bankshares operated 49 branches, strategically located with 17 in West Virginia, 23 in Virginia, 7 in North Carolina, and 2 in Tennessee. Headquartered in Bluefield, Virginia, the bank has established a significant regional presence.

Key Financial Metrics

Return on equity for First Community Bankshares, Inc. stands at 9.6%, a gauge of how efficiently it converts shareholder capital into profit. Return on assets is 1.3%, showing how much profit it generates from its asset base. FCBC trades at a trailing price-to-earnings ratio of 17.10, roughly in line with the Financial Services sector average of ~18x. Its free cash flow yield is 3.9%, a gauge of the cash the business throws off relative to its market value. Its earnings yield is 5.7%, the inverse of the P/E and a quick read on earnings relative to price.

Financial Health

First Community Bankshares, Inc.'s Piotroski F-Score is 4/9, a 9-point checklist of profitability, leverage and efficiency — a middling fundamental profile. Its Altman Z-Score of -0.34 places it in the distress zone, a signal of elevated financial risk.
